Prohibition on export of wheat – Exemption for export of wheat to Afghanistan

To be published in the Gazette of India Extraordinary Part II Section 3, Sub Section (ii)
Government of India
Ministry of Commerce & Industry
Department of Commerce
Directorate General of Foreign Trade
Udyog Bhawan
 
Notification No. 27(RE-2010)/2009-2014
New Delhi, the 28 February, 2011 

Subject:  Prohibition on export of wheat – Exemption for export of wheat to Afghanistan. 

S.O. (E)        In exercise of the powers conferred by Section 5 of Foreign Trade (Development & Regulation) Act, 1992 (No.22 of 1992) read with Para 2.1 of the Foreign Trade Policy, 2009-2014, the Central Government hereby makes, the following addition with immediate effect at the end of Paragraph No. 2 of Notification No. 33(RE-2007)/2004-2009, dated 08.10.2007, as amended from time to time (pertaining to prohibition on export of wheat and wheat products).
 
2.       In Notification No. 33(RE-2007)/2004-2009, dated 08.10.2007, sub para 2.10 was added on 12.05.2010 vide Notification No. 40/2009-14.  Now another sub-para 2.11 is added as under:
 
“2.11       The prohibition imposed by Notification No. 33(RE-2007)/2004-2009, dated 08.10.2007 on export of wheat shall not be applicable to export of 1,00,000 MT of wheat to Afghanistan through Food Corporation of India.”           
 
3.         This quantity shall be exported by Food Corporation of India out of the Central Pool stock during the Financial Year 2010-11 i.e. upto 31.03.2011. 
 
4.       Effect of this notification:
 
The export of 1,00,000 MTs of wheat to Afghanistan, as a donation from Government of India to the Government of Islamic Republic of Afghanistan will be permitted for export through FCI. upto 31.03.2011.
